Regional Management(RM) - 2025 Q1 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-04-30 21:00
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company reported a net income of $7 million and diluted EPS of $0.70 for Q1 2025, consistent with guidance but lower than Q1 2024 due to a prior year loan sale benefit [4][20] - Ending net receivables increased by 8% year over year, marking the fastest growth rate since 2023 [5] - Total revenue reached $153 million in Q1 2025, up 6% from the prior year, or 7.4% when adjusted for loan sale revenue benefits [24]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The auto secured loan portfolio grew by $59 million or 37% year over year, now representing 12% of the total portfolio [7] - The small loan portfolio increased by 11% year over year, with 18% of the portfolio carrying an APR greater than 36%, up from 16% a year ago [22] - New branches opened in September 2024 generated $1.5 million in revenue against $1.1 million in G&A expenses, demonstrating strong performance [6]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company opened 15 new branches, 10 of which are in new markets, and these branches are performing well with an average portfolio balance of $2.2 million [5][6] - The thirty plus day delinquency rate was 7.1%, flat year over year, but improved by 20 basis points when adjusted for the impact of growth in higher margin portfolios [9][25]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company aims for a minimum of 10% portfolio growth in 2025 despite economic uncertainties, supported by a conservative credit box and strong capital generation [12][33] - The barbell strategy focuses on growth in high-quality auto secured and higher margin small loan portfolios, which are expected to continue performing well [7][22] - The company is prepared to tighten credit further if necessary, having already entered a potential downturn with a tightened credit box [11][13]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in navigating economic uncertainties due to a strong credit performance and a conservative underwriting approach [12][13] - The company is closely monitoring macroeconomic conditions, including inflation and consumer behavior, to adjust strategies as needed [10][45] - Management highlighted the resilience of their customer base, supported by wage growth and job availability [13][45] Other Important Information - The company generated $9.9 million in total capital in Q1 2025, with total capital generation since 2020 amounting to $339 million [17] - The allowance for credit losses was $199 million, with a reserve rate of 10.5%, expected to decline to 10.3% in Q2 2025 [12][27] - The company declared a dividend of $0.30 per share for Q2 2025, with a share repurchase program in place [33] Q&A Session Summary Question: Long-term outlook on NIM - Management indicated that as fixed-rate funding matures, the cost of funds will increase, but higher margin business will balance this [39][40] Question: Changes in consumer behavior - Management noted that consumer credit results are tracking as expected, with no significant changes in demand or payment behavior observed [44][45] Question: Guidance on expenses - Management provided Q2 guidance of approximately $65.5 million in G&A expenses, with increases expected as loan volumes rise [28][85] Question: Clarification on capital generation - Management explained that Q1 capital generation was lower due to seasonal factors, with expectations for improvement as the year progresses [58][59] Question: Credit box tightening - Management confirmed that they apply stress factors in underwriting, adjusting based on portfolio risk, rather than a uniform tightening approach [62][63]

Franklin Street Properties (FSP) - 2025 Q1 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-04-30 15:00
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company reported funds from operations (FFO) of approximately $2.7 million or $0.03 per share for Q1 2025 [5] - A GAAP net loss of about $21.4 million or $0.21 per share was recorded for the same period [6]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The directly owned portfolio was approximately 69.2% leased at the end of Q1 2025, down from 70.3% at the end of Q4 2024 [9] - Economic occupancy for the directly owned portfolio was approximately 67.7% at the end of Q1 2025, compared to 68.6% at the end of 2024 [9] - Approximately 60,000 square feet of total leasing was finalized during Q1 2025, consisting entirely of renewals and expansions [10]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company has tracked approximately 800,000 square feet of prospective new tenants, with about 300,000 square feet of prospects identifying FSP assets on their shortlist [11] - Scheduled lease expirations for the remainder of 2025 total approximately 246,000 square feet, representing about 5.1% of FSP's directly owned portfolio [12]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company remains focused on advancing leasing of space in its existing property portfolio and pursuing property dispositions to repay debt [6][7] - The company is actively considering operational adjustments and strategic transactions to unlock the full value of its property portfolio [8]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management noted macroeconomic uncertainties, including tariff headlines, that could impact corporate leasing decisions and investment in office properties [7] - The company remains confident in its direction but is open to various strategies to maximize shareholder value [9] Other Important Information - Since initiating its current disposition strategy in late 2020, the company has completed approximately $1.1 billion in property sales, leading to a nearly 75% reduction in corporate indebtedness [13] - National office transaction volumes rose by 22% in 2024 and accelerated in Q1 2025, finishing 31% higher year over year [15] Q&A Session Summary Question: Insight on why leasing was solely executed for renewals during Q1 - Management indicated that new leases had stalled but they are pursuing renewal transactions and expect positive news in Q2 and Q3 [17][18] Question: Which geographies currently depict greater strength in the portfolio? - Management highlighted strong demand in Texas, particularly in Houston, with Dallas showing some improvement, while Denver and Minneapolis are better than previous years but not as robust as Texas suburbs [19]

TETRA TECHNOLOGIES, INC. ANNOUNCES FIRST QUARTER 2025 RESULTS AND UPDATES FIRST-HALF 2025 GUIDANCE
Prnewswire· 2025-04-29 21:00
Financial Performance - TETRA Technologies reported a record first-quarter Adjusted EBITDA of $32.3 million, a 41% increase sequentially and year-over-year, driven by strong performance in Completion Fluids and Products [2][3] - Total revenue for the first quarter was $157 million, reflecting a 17% sequential increase and a 4% increase compared to the previous year [2][8] - Net income before taxes and discontinued operations was $5.1 million, down from $7.4 million in the prior quarter due to unrealized mark-to-market gains [8] Segment Performance - Completion Fluids & Products generated revenue of $93 million, with adjusted EBITDA margins increasing to 35.7% from 27.3% in the previous quarter, supported by stronger deepwater activity [3][9] - Water & Flowback Services experienced a 2% decline in revenue sequentially, but adjusted EBITDA margins improved year-over-year by 340 basis points despite lower frac activity levels [3][11] Outlook and Guidance - The company anticipates a strong second quarter, expecting to benefit from seasonal peaks in European industrial chemicals and the completion of multiple deepwater projects [4] - Adjusted EBITDA guidance for the first half of 2025 has been revised to between $57 million and $65 million, with revenue guidance adjusted to between $315 million and $345 million [4] Cash Flow and Capital Expenditures - TETRA generated $3.9 million in cash from operating activities and $4.2 million in free cash flow during the first quarter, after investing $11.2 million in the Arkansas bromine project [5][18] - Total capital expenditures for the quarter were $18 million, with significant investments directed towards the Arkansas bromine facility [18][20] Balance Sheet and Liquidity - As of March 31, 2025, the company had cash and cash equivalents of $41 million and long-term debt of $180 million, resulting in a net leverage ratio of 1.5X [20][19] - Liquidity improved to $220 million as of April 28, 2025, including an unused $75 million delayed draw feature under the Term Credit Agreement [19] Emerging Growth Initiatives - TETRA is advancing its desalination project, TETRA Oasis TDS, in collaboration with EOG Resources, targeting the recycling of produced water for beneficial reuse [13] - The company is positioned to benefit from increased sales of battery electrolytes to Eos Energy Enterprises as they ramp up production [14]
WASTE CONNECTIONS REPORTS FIRST QUARTER 2025 RESULTS
Prnewswire· 2025-04-23 20:05
Core Insights - Waste Connections reported strong financial results for Q1 2025, driven by price-led organic solid waste growth and continued acquisition activity, resulting in a revenue of $2.228 billion, a 7.5% increase year-over-year [3][9] - The company achieved an adjusted EBITDA margin of 32.0%, reflecting a 60 basis point improvement compared to the previous year, and adjusted net income increased to $293.1 million, or $1.13 per diluted share [4][9] - The company continues to focus on acquisitions, with annualized revenues from acquisitions exceeding $125 million, including a new recycling facility in New Jersey [2][9] Financial Performance - Revenue for Q1 2025 was $2.228 billion, up from $2.073 billion in Q1 2024 [3] - Operating income increased to $390.2 million from $366.8 million year-over-year, with net income rising to $241.5 million, or $0.93 per diluted share [3][4] - Adjusted EBITDA for the quarter was $712.2 million, compared to $650.7 million in the prior year [4][9] Operational Highlights - Core solid waste pricing increased by 6.9%, despite facing volume weakness due to adverse weather conditions [2][15] - Employee retention improved for the tenth consecutive quarter, and the company achieved record safety performance during the period [2] - The company reported net cash provided by operating activities of $541.5 million and adjusted free cash flow of $332.1 million [9][23] Acquisition Strategy - Waste Connections has maintained a robust acquisition strategy, with over $125 million in annualized revenue from acquisitions completed to date [2][9] - The company continues to leverage its strong financial position and free cash flow generation to pursue above-average acquisition activity in 2025 [2] Market Position - Waste Connections serves approximately nine million customers across 46 states in the U.S. and six provinces in Canada, focusing on non-hazardous waste services and resource recovery [7] - The company emphasizes its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) initiatives as integral to its long-term value creation strategy [7]
Inspired Reports Fourth Quarter and Year End 2024 Results
Globenewswire· 2025-03-17 12:24
Core Insights - Inspired Entertainment, Inc. reported strong financial results for Q4 2024, with total revenue of $83.0 million, a 2% increase year-over-year, primarily driven by a 45% growth in the Interactive segment [7][11] - The company achieved a net income of $68.0 million for Q4 2024, compared to a net loss of $1.7 million in Q4 2023, indicating a significant turnaround [7][11] - Adjusted EBITDA for Q4 2024 was $30.9 million, up 22% from the previous year, with the Interactive segment's Adjusted EBITDA growing by 105% year-over-year [7][11] Financial Performance - The Interactive segment saw a revenue increase of 45% year-over-year, reaching $11.6 million, while the Gaming segment's revenue was $38.8 million, a slight decrease of 1% [9][11] - The Leisure segment reported a 7% revenue increase to $22.5 million, driven by Vantage deployments and growth in bingo and holiday park businesses [5][11] - The Virtual Sports segment faced challenges, with revenue declining by 22% to $10.1 million, but the company is optimistic about future growth through strategic measures [4][11] Operational Highlights - The company successfully launched the MGM Bonus City game with BetMGM in Michigan and the Hybrid Dealer Roulette game in Canada, indicating progress in its Hybrid Dealer rollout strategy [2][4] - A partnership with William Hill is advancing, with the installation of 5,000 new Vantage cabinets expected to drive further growth [3][11] - The company is focusing on expanding its digital businesses and optimizing land-based operations, with a commitment to investing in new market opportunities [6][11] Segment Performance - For the full year 2024, the Interactive segment's revenue increased by 41% to $39.3 million, while the Gaming segment's revenue decreased by 1% to $110.6 million [11] - The Virtual Sports segment's full-year revenue declined by 19% to $45.4 million, but the company remains confident in its long-term potential [10][11] - The Leisure segment's full-year revenue grew by 6% to $101.8 million, reflecting steady growth across its various businesses [11] Strategic Initiatives - The company is implementing strategic measures to streamline its Virtual Sports segment and unify product and platform teams under cohesive leadership [4][11] - Inspired Entertainment is expanding its mobile and slot games catalog in Brazil, indicating a focus on new market opportunities [8][11] - The company has extended its partnership with Aristocrat Interactive to provide V-Lottery Virtual Sports games to the Virginia Lottery, enhancing its product offerings [10][11]
